3 Common Root Causes Of Water Stains on Walls


Unlike popular belief, water spots on wall surfaces do not always come from inadequate building materials. There are a number of sources of water stains on walls. These consist of:

Poor Drain


When making a structure strategy, it is critical to make certain adequate drainage. This will stop water from permeating into the walls. Where the drain system is obstructed or missing, underground wetness develops. This web links to too much moisture that you notice on the walls of your building.
So, the leading reason for wet walls, in this situation, can be an inadequate water drainage system. It can likewise be because of bad administration of sewer pipelines that go through the structure.

Wet


When warm wet air meets completely dry cold air, it causes water droplets to form on the walls of buildings. This occurs in kitchens and bathrooms when there is steam from cooking or showers. The water beads can tarnish the bordering walls in these parts of your house as well as spread to other areas.
Damp or condensation affects the roof covering and also wall surfaces of structures. This triggers them to appear darker than other areas of the residence. When the wall surface is wet, it produces an appropriate atmosphere for the growth of fungis as well as microbes. These may have adverse results on wellness, such as allergic reactions as well as respiratory problems.

Pipe Leaks


Most homes have a network of water pipelines within the wall surfaces. It always increases the stability of such pipelines, as there is little oxygen within the walls.
A disadvantage to this is that water leakage affects the wall surfaces of the structure and creates prevalent damage. A telltale sign of malfunctioning pipelines is the look of a water stain on the wall surface.

Water Discolorations on Wall Surface: Repair Service Tips


When dealing with water discolorations, homeowners would normally want a fast fix. Yet, they would certainly soon recognize this is disadvantageous as the water spots reoccur. So, below are a few practical suggestions that will lead you in the fixing of water stains on walls:
  • Always deal with the reason for water discolorations on walls

  • Involve the help of expert repair services

  • Technique routine hygiene and clear out clogged up sewage systems

  • When constructing a home in a waterlogged area, make certain that the workers carry out correct grading

  • Tiling areas that are prone to high condensation, such as the bathroom and kitchen, aids in reducing the build-up of wet

  • Dehumidifiers are also valuable in maintaining the moisture levels at bay

  • Pro Idea


    A houseplant in your house also enhances its moisture. So, if the house is already humid, you may intend to introduce houseplants with very little transpiration. An instance of suitable houseplants is succulents.

    CHECKING FOR WATER DAMAGE


    Water damage can be costly, and it may begin before you even notice the first signs of trouble. Water damage can cause mold and mildew in your walls and floors, which can create an abundance of health concerns for your family. It can also lead to costly repairs of various appliances and general home fixtures. To avoid the pricey consequences of water damage, here are Warner Service’s top 5 places you should check:


  • The walls – The easiest place to spot the beginnings of water damage is on the walls and ceilings of your home. If water damage is present, there will most likely be water stains, especially around the windows and doorframes, and/or cracks in the drywall. If a stain looks unusual (discolored to brown, black or gray, raised texture), has a swollen appearance or is soft to the touch, contact a professional immediately.


  • The pipes – To avoid water damage, consistently check the pipes in your kitchen (especially the dishwasher and ice maker), bathrooms, laundry room (specifically washing machines) and basement for corrosion, leaks and water stains. Pay special attention to where the pipes connect in your home and the location of caulking around the bathroom fixtures, including toilets, sinks, showers and tubs. Missing or loose caulking and grout could be signs of leaking water. This seepage can also quickly cause mold and rust, so double check your water heater and tank for wet spots on the floor.


  • The floor – Water damage is very easy to spot on the floor. Look for any warping or buckling of the material, especially in the basement. If your home has wood flooring, look for bright white or dark stains. If your home has carpeting, keep it dry and clean. A damp carpet that smells of mold could cause water damage and health problems. To avoid this, consider installing floor pans under your appliances to help prevent damages from small, slow and undetected leaks.


  • The basement and attic – If your basement or attic smells odd check for mold and mildew around the area, especially the valley where the roof meets. While you are inspecting those areas, check for wall cracks, floor stains, rust and dampness in the insulation. If you live in a colder and/or rainier climate, perform routine checks for water damage from melting snow or ice and rain.


  • The exterior – Check the roof for damaged flashing and missing, cracked or curled shingles. There should also be no standing water anywhere outside your home. This could be caused by puddles, leaky rain gutters or hoses, poor drainage, or short gutter spouts. Invest in a sump pump system or water flow monitoring system, and perform routine maintenance on these outdoor appliances to avoid indoor water damage.
